Meeting was called to order by Michael Goldblatt at 6:36 pm, a quorum was present.
Pete Desaulniers explained that this special finan.cial meeting was called to discuss
operations, staffing and contracts.
Discussion took place regarding summer schedule at the Rink and the validity of closing
during the months of July and August. Jim Sanca expressed the lack of elite programs
run by the Rink to justify opening year round. Authority members feel there is a
responsibility to the public to offer year round access and programs, in particular public
skate, in a city-owned venue. Pete Desaulniers made a motion to maintain year-round
operations and not closing for extended periods of time. Mike Schermerhorn seconded
it. After no further discussion took place, motion was approved unanimously.
Pete Desaulniers presented the Authority a proposed document outlining Authority and
Rink management responsibilities and discussion took place. fJ,.f(i~
The Authority ""ill:
Provide quarterly operational and financial reports to the City Council
Provide necessary training to Rink employees. Currently there is an immediate
need for training in marketing/PR and customer service.
Approve budgets submitted by Rink management
Rink Management will:
Create budgets for the fiscal year. Budgets should cover operational costs of Rink
and provide for capital improvements

Recommend staffing with final approval by the Authority. It was noted that Rink
management needs to better supervise and manage staff. Pete Desaulniers made a
motion to eliminate the Finance Director position effective June 30, 2012. Cheryl
Ritacco seconded. Discussion took place. The position. has been targeted by City
Council for the past year as a possible elimination. City would handle all Rink
finances. After no further discussion, motion was unanimously approved.
Day-to-day operations such as vendors/pro shop/snack bar, rink maintenance and
group communications pertaining to ice availability will be the responsibility of
Rink management.
The Authority has asked that all contracts be brought to their attention and to include
them in. the approval process. An official process needs to be established for future
contract presentation and review. Currently u.nder consideration is a contract between
the Rink and Rob Francis and Yulia Borissova for weekly ice rental during the months of
July and August. Mike Schermerhorn made a motion to accept the contract for the
period of .July 9, 2012 - August 247 2.012 for ice rental Monday, Wednesday, Thursday
and Friday 9 - Ham. Cheryl Ritacco seconded it. After no further discussion took place,
motion was approved unanimously.
A top priority for the Rink and the Authority is to work with Norwich residents and
surrounding communities to foster stronger, more positive relationships. The current
negative publicity and feelings tbat are surrounding the Rink need to chan,ge and
naysayers need to become ambassadors. Ways to change perception need to be
discussed and acted upon.
